Summary
The NCAA Women’s Basketball Tournament field was revealed, with UConn, South Carolina, UCLA, and Texas earning the top seeds. The Huskies are the only undefeated team in Division I college basketball, led by Sarah Strong and Azzi Fudd. The tournament begins on Friday and Saturday, with the Final Four taking place on April 3 and the championship on April 5. The First Four matchups include Missouri and Stephen F. Austin and Southern and Samford fighting for the No. 16 seeds.
